- The distance between Tak, Thailand and Cheju, North Korea is approximately 3,301 km or 2,052 mi.
- To reach Tak in this distance one would set out from Cheju bearing 242.7°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tak bearing 230.7° or SW .
- Tak has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Cheju has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The average annual temperature is 12 °C (21.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.7 °C (22.9°F) less in Tak.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 359.8 mm (14.2 in) less which is equivalent to 359.8 l/m² (8.83 US gal/ft²) or 3,598,000 l/ha (384,650 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.4° higher in Tak than in Cheju.
